Thor Explorations Ltd (TSX-V:THX, AIM:THX, OTC:THXPF) told investors that a final report, in relation to its dispute with Nigeria’s Osun State Government, has confirmed that it has complied with its legal and regulatory obligations.
The report, by an ‘Inter-Ministerial Fact-Finding Committee’, also confirmed that allegations of wrongdoing were unfounded, Thor added.
Additionally, the committee ruled that a ₦3.25 billion ($2.09 million) tax invoice was not valid, and, a new revised invoice of ₦98.35 million ($64,100) has been issued and is now subject to reconciliation.
It also confirmed there was no evidence of environmental pollution and no basis for additional environmental levies, Thor noted.
